Baseball's Injury Woes: A Season Cut Short

The world of baseball is abuzz with the news that Ramón Laureano, the talented Padres outfielder, has undergone hip surgery, effectively ending his season. This development is a significant blow to the team's lineup and raises questions about the impact of injuries on player performance and team dynamics.

Roster Adjustments and Implications

As if one injury wasn't enough, the Padres are also dealing with right-hander Jeremiah Estrada's knee soreness, leading to his placement on the 15-day injured list. This double whammy of injuries is a manager's nightmare, forcing the team to make swift roster adjustments.

What I find particularly interesting is the domino effect these injuries can have. With Estrada out, the Padres are recalling David Morgan to fill the roster spot. This move not only impacts the team's pitching strategy but also showcases the importance of having a deep bench to mitigate such setbacks.
